Well, first, if you're using a low quality source like an MP3 then don't even think about an expensive piece of kit like a Transporter!
So, consider instead playing back a lossless format such as FLAC - what difference can the player make? Enormous!! The biggest difference will be in the quality of the DAC which converts the bits to an analog signal. Even if you use the device as a pure digital transport sending the bits on to the same downstream DAC, you'll still get differences (which you may or may not be able to detect depending on your ears and the rest of your kit) due to digital imperfections like jitter. If this were not the case, all CD players would sound the same, which they most obviously do not...
